Key Features of ASME SB167 Inconel 600 Pipe:

High Strength and Durability: This alloy has high tensile and yield strengths, making it suitable for high-pressure applications.
Corrosion Resistance: Inconel 600 alloy pipe offers excellent resistance to a wide range of corrosive environments, including chlorides, acidic, and alkaline solutions.
High-Temperature Resistance: This alloy can withstand a wide temperature range, from cryogenics to 2000°F (1095°C), making it suitable for a variety of applications.
Applications: Common uses include heat exchangers, boiler tubes, chemical processing equipment, aerospace components, and nuclear power generation systems.

ASME SB167 Inconel 600 boiler tube is a seamless tube made from a nickel-chromium alloy known for its excellent corrosion and heat resistance. These tubes are commonly used in high-temperature and high-pressure applications, including boiler systems, heat exchangers, and chemical processing equipment.

ASTM B167 Inconel 600 Seamless Tubes Chemical Composition, UNS NO6600

Ni + Co Cr Fe C Mn S Si Cu
72.0 min 14.0-17.0 6.0-10.0 .15 max 1.00 max .015 max .50 max .50 max

ASTM B167 Inconel 600 Seamless Tubes Mechanical Properties

Product Form Condition Tensile (ksi) .2% Yield (ksi) Elongation (%) Hardness (HRB)
Tube & Pipe ot-Finished 75-100 25-50 35*55 -
Tube & Pipe Cold-Drawn 80-100 25-50 35-55 88
